Understanding Enamel — and Why It Matters
Enamel is the hardest substance in the human body, even stronger than bone. Yet despite its strength, it has one major limitation: it contains no living cells.
Enamel cannot self-repair once damaged. Daily acid from bacteria, sugar, and acidic foods removes minerals from enamel—a process called demineralization. Teeth are constantly within a delicate balance of demineralization and remineralization, promoted by the absorption of ions from saliva. The problem is that natural remineralization is inefficient — it does not always remineralize the deeper area of the tooth, and it takes too long.
The continuous presence of enamel-damaging substances eventually overwhelms the body ability to repair, leading to:
- White spot lesions
- Early caries (incipient decay)
- Chalky or opaque enamel areas
- Post-orthodontic white spots
Historically, once decay crossed a certain threshold, the only option was restorative dentistry. But what if we could intervene before a cavity forms?
What Is Enamel Regeneration?
Enamel regeneration does not mean growing a brand-new tooth. Instead, it refers to rebuilding the mineral structure of early enamel lesions by guiding natural remineralization in a highly targeted way.
Saliva tries to remineralize teeth with calcium and phosphate ions. But natural remineralization is often too slow or superficial to reverse early decay.
Modern biomimetic technologies enhance and direct this natural process — and this is where Curodont comes in.
What Is Curodont®?
Curodont® is a non-invasive enamel regeneration treatment based on a technology called self-assembling peptide (P11-4). Rather than covering or replacing damaged enamel, Curodont works at a microscopic level to rebuild it from within.
How It Works
- 1Application — The dentist applies Curodont liquid directly onto an early carious lesion.
- 2Peptide Activation — The self-assembling peptides diffuse into the porous enamel lesion.
- 3Matrix Formation — Inside the lesion, the peptides assemble into a 3D scaffold that mimics the natural development of enamel.
- 4Mineral Attraction — Calcium and phosphate from saliva are attracted to this scaffold.
- 5Enamel Regeneration — New hydroxyapatite crystals begin forming, strengthening, and regenerating enamel structure over time.
In simple terms: Curodont creates the conditions for the tooth to heal itself.

Who Is a Candidate for Curodont?
Curodont is most effective for early-stage enamel lesions, including:
- Initial cavities not yet requiring fillings
- White spot lesions
- Early smooth-surface decay
- Patients with high caries risk
- Pediatric and teenage patients
- Patients seeking minimally invasive dentistry
It is important to understand that advanced cavities still require restorative treatment. Timing and early diagnosis are key.

What Patients Should Expect
A typical Curodont appointment is simple:
- 1Examination and diagnosis of early lesions
- 2Tooth cleaning and isolation
- 3Application of the Curodont solution
- 4Fluoride support treatment (if indicated)
- 5Monitoring over future visits
The procedure usually takes only a few minutes and requires no anesthesia. Over the following weeks and months, enamel continues to strengthen as minerals integrate into the scaffold structure.
